Best time to go

The best time to visit Piran is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October). During these months, the weather is mild and there are fewer tourists.

Where to Go

There are a number of things to see and do in Piran.

  • Tartini Square: Tartini Square is the main square in Piran. It is home to a number of restaurants, cafes, and shops.
  • St. George's Church: St. George's Church is a 15th-century church located on a hill overlooking Piran. It offers stunning views of the town and the surrounding countryside.
  • The Piran City Walls: The Piran City Walls were built in the 15th century to protect the town from attack. They offer a unique perspective on the town and the surrounding countryside.
